    Analysis of Fractional Factorials 

    Meyer, R. Daniel (1986-06)
    Statistically designed experiments, particularly fractional factorial designs, are key tools to use when the object is to screen a large number of variables in order to identify those with the most influence.

    Analysis of Unreplicated Factorials Allowing for Possibly Faulty Observations 

    Meyer, R. Daniel; Box, George (1987)
    Inaccurate data points are particularly troublesome in the analysis of unreplicated factorial experiments, but new techniques allow investigators to overcome this difficulty.
